I am currently using Jigoshop on one of my sites. As they say in the drug world...the first one is free. The product itself is free, but most of the compatible themes and the extensions to make it work for you are not free. WooCommerce is similar in this regard.

One issue that I have in particular with Jigoshop is that it started off in essentially beta mode when we started using it about 2 years ago. It has since gone through about 12 significant updates. Keeping up to date so that all of the pieces keep working together is a chore. We try to do these updates in our off season, so we often have to roll through several updates sequentially, upgrading the database each time. We have learned you cannot skip a version or all hell breaks loose.

If I did it again, I probably would go with WooCommerce as it seems a bit more mature.
